About the Role
Reporting to the Operations Manager, the MSO will oversee service delivery, personnel, client relations, and financial performance for a key account in the Austin, TX area. You’ll be instrumental in optimizing workflows, mentoring staff, and driving operational excellence.
Key Responsibilities:
Operational Leadership
- Oversee daily operations and ensure consistent, high-quality service delivery.
- Manage staffing, scheduling, onboarding, and employee development.
- Maintain compliance with internal policies, procedures, and contractual obligations.
Client Relationship Management
- Partner with Medical Client Leads (MCLs) to identify and resolve client issues.
- Lead client meetings, provide service updates, and manage client expectations.
- Support invoicing processes by providing timely and accurate information.
Team Development & Culture
- Promote a positive, productive work environment across all levels.
- Recruit, train, and retain top talent; provide coaching and mentorship.
- Collaborate with HR to maintain appropriate staffing levels and performance standards.
Strategic and Financial Oversight
- Manage and monitor budgets to ensure optimal resource allocation.
- Participate in planning and decision-making that aligns with company goals.
- Analyze trends and challenges to improve operational efficiency.
Communication & Collaboration
- Maintain clear communication with clients, employees, and leadership teams.
- Be readily available via phone and video to support remote and on-site operations.
- Host regular team meetings and provide real-time updates and support.
What You Bring:
Required
- 2–3 years of experience managing employees and leading teams.
- Strong proficiency in Microsoft Office, particularly Excel.
- Healthcare management experience; Associates or Bachelor's degree in healthcare or related field .
- Background in healthcare operations or service delivery, occupational health experience
